Analog Devices VisualDSP 50 Licensing Guide Rev 14
Have a look at the manual Analog Devices VisualDSP 50 Licensing Guide Rev 14 online for free. It’s possible to download the document as PDF or print. UserManuals.tech offer 11 Analog Devices manuals and user’s guides for free. Share the user manual or guide on Facebook, Twitter or Google+.
VisualDSP++ 5 Licensing Guide 6-17 Troubleshooting Problem: The serial number you have entered is no longer valid. Please contact Support ([email protected] or 1-800-analogd) to update your serial number. Solution: VisualDSP++ has detected that the serial number you are trying to install is no longer valid. Certain serial numbers have been made obso- lete over the years. Contact Support with your current serial number, and you will be issued with a replacement. For more information, refer to Licensing Support. Problem: VisualDSP++ has detected an invalid serial number. Please verify the serial number is accurate with the one received with the VisualDSP++ product. If the problem persists, please contact Analog Devices technical sup- port at http://www.analog.com/support. Solution: VisualDSP++ detected an invalid serial number in your license.dat file. This error can occur when your license.dat file con- tains a once-valid serial number that has been made obsolete in later versions of VisualDSP++. In this case, contact Support with your current serial number and you will be issued a replacement serial number. For more information, refer to Licensing Support. Problem: The serial number you entered is a Server serial number. Please run the server license installation program to use this serial number. Solution: The serial number you are trying to install is a floating license serial number. This must be installed through the separate Floating License Server application, rather than through the VisualDSP++ IDDE. Refer to Installing a Floating License Server for further details.
Error Messages 6-18 VisualDSP++ 5 Licensing GuideProblem: The validation code that you entered is invalid. Please re-enter the code, ensuring that you type the code EXACTLY as you received it. It might be helpful to copy-and-paste your validation code rather than typing it manually. Solution: VisualDSP++ detected that you entered an invalid serial num- ber. Ensure that you have entered the correct validation code, exactly as given. Validation codes are valid for a particular combination of serial number and host ID. If you are trying to install your serial number on a different machine than the one you initially registered, you will need a new validation code. Refer to Registering and Validat- ing Your License for further details. From VisualDSP++ 5 onwards, license strings (and therefore validation codes) have changed in format. Consequently, when registering your serial number and host ID, two validation codes will be e-mailed to you. One is valid for VisualDSP++ 4.5 and earlier versions; the is valid for VisualDSP++ 5 and later versions. Ensure that you install the appropriate validation code for the version of VisualDSP++ you are using. If you continue to have problems, e-mail processor.tools.registra- [email protected] , identifying your serial number, validation code, and host ID. Problem: The file does not contain valid client license information. Solution: VisualDSP++ detected an invalid client license file. Ensure that you select the correct client-license.dat file. Problem: The filename as entered could not be found. Ensure that the path is correct and the file exists.
VisualDSP++ 5 Licensing Guide 6-19 Troubleshooting Solution: VisualDSP++ detected that an invalid path or file name has been entered for the location of the client-license.dat file. Ensure that the path is correct and the file exists. Problem: Error: Cannot find a valid license path Solution: VisualDSP++ was not able to find the given path to the license.dat file. This indicates that the registry setting that stores the location of your license.dat file is incorrect, missing, or has been cor- rupted. Try uninstalling, rebooting, and reinstalling VisualDSP++. If the problem persists, contact Support for further assistance. For more information, refer to Licensing Support. Problem: Failed to delete the license file: C:\Program Files\Analog Devices\VisualDSP++ \System\license.dat -- or -- Failed to copy the license file to: C:\Program Files\Analog Devices\Visu- alDSP++ \System\license.client_backup -- or -- Failed to open the license file: C:\Program Files\Analog Devices\Visu- alDSP++ \System\license.dat -- or -- Failed to copy the license file to C:\Program Files\Analog Devices\Visu- alDSP++ \System
Error Messages 6-20 VisualDSP++ 5 Licensing GuideSolution: VisualDSP++ had a problem accessing the license.dat file located in the \System folder. This can be caused by the System folder, parent folders, or the license.dat file itself having read-only permission, by the file currently being held open by another application, or by another disk/file access problem. Verify that the file and folders have the proper settings to enable copying files and try again. If the problem persists, contact Support for further assistance. For more information, refer to Licensing Support. Problem: Invalid license file. The license file may either be damaged or missing. Please confirm that the following file exists: C:\Program Files\Analog Devices\VisualDSP++ \System\license.dat Solution: VisualDSP++ had a problem accessing the license.dat file located in the \System folder. This can be caused by the System folder, parent folders, or the license.dat file itself having read-only permission, by the file currently being held open by another application, or by another disk/file access problem. Verify that the file and folders have the proper settings to enable copying files and try again. This can also be caused by a license.dat file that includes invalid information. If the problem persists, contract Support for assistance. For more information, refer to Licensing Support. Problem: Error: Failed to get a valid host id Solution: VisualDSP++ was not able to get a valid host ID from your computer, which is a modified version of the volume serial number. From the C:\ drive, try running the “vol” command from the command prompt to verify that you have a physical hard drive with a volume serial number.
VisualDSP++ 5 Licensing Guide 6-21 Troubleshooting If you do not have a hard drive (or if your setup results in you having no C:\ drive), run ipconfig/all from the command prompt to verify that you have a MAC address (the physical address of the network card). If you have a volume serial number or a MAC address, try uninstalling, reboot- ing, and reinstalling VisualDSP++ to see whether that fixes the problem. If the problem persists, contact Support for further assistance. For more information, refer to Licensing Support. Errors Issued in the Output Window or on the Command Line Problem: Error code: 0x80040112 Error description: Target not licensed for use Solution: This error is issued when trying to connect to a debug session. VisualDSP++ was not able to find a license for the specific processor type with which you are currently working. This means that your license is not installed correctly or that you are attempting to run a debug session for which you are not licensed. Examples of the latter problem include attempting to run a SHARC debug session when you only have a Blackfin license installed, or attempting to run an EZ-KIT Lite debug session when you only have a test drive license installed.For more information, refer to Licensing Overview. Problem: Error: cc1458: Fatal Error: could not obtain license Solution: This error is caused by the compiler. The compiler could not find a license.dat file. Ensure that your license is correctly installed and that it is for the same architecture as the target processor of the project you are trying to build. Contact Support if you require further assistance. For more information, refer to Licensing Support.
Error Messages 6-22 VisualDSP++ 5 Licensing GuideProblem: [Error: ea1156] Failed to get a license to run the assembler Solution: This error is issued by the assembler. The assembler could not find a valid license.dat file. Ensure that your license is correctly installed and that it is for the same architecture as the target processor of the project you are trying to build. Contact Support if you require further assistance. For more information, refer to Licensing Support. Problem: Error li1143 Failed to obtain license Solution: This error is issued by the linker. The linker could not find a valid license.dat file. Ensure that your license is correctly installed and that it is for the same architecture as the target processor of the project you are trying to build. Contact Support if you require further assistance. For more information, refer to Licensing Support. Problem: Error li1042 22742 (more than 22K) are used by code, while only 20KB are allowed under EZ-KIT Lite license restriction Solution: This error is caused by the linker. Evaluation licenses restrict the amount of internal program memory that is available to the processor. The exact amount that is available varies with each EZ-KIT Lite. If you want to increase the available memory, upgrade to a full license. For fur- ther information, refer to the EZ-KIT Lite manual.
VisualDSP++ 5 Licensing Guide 6-23 Troubleshooting VisualDSP++ Floating License Server-Specific Errors VisualDSP++ Floating License Server-Specific errors include: Errors Issued in Message Boxes Errors Issued by FLEXnet Tools Errors Issued in Message Boxes Problem: The license manager has detected that a server license is being used and that there is a problem communicating with the license server software. This could be due to an out-of date version of the license server software or there is not a network connection with the license server. Please check your connection to the network or if your the server software is out-of-date update the server tools using the latest license server installation. The license server installer can be downloaded from http://www.analog.com/en/processors-dsp/software-and-reference-designs/con- tent/visualdsp_tools_upgrades/fca.html. Solution: VisualDSP++ has detected a problem while communicating with the VisualDSP++ Floating License Server. This error is usually followed by a second error, headed “Flexible License Manager”, which gives specific FLEXnet error codes, and which may help you narrow down the problem when referring to the FLEXnet Licensing End Users Guide. Likely causes include: A problem with your connection to the network The instructions outlined in Installing a Floating License Server have not been followed correctly The version of the License Server Manager you are using is not a recent enough version for the version of VisualDSP++ that you are using. For VisualDSP++ 5, version 2.00.7 or later must be installed.
Error Messages 6-24 VisualDSP++ 5 Licensing Guide The FLEXnet service is not running For details on how to check this, refer to the FAQ entitled “How do I check whether my FLEXnet service is running?” A firewall is running on one or both machines. If so, contact Support for information on working with FLEXnet licensing with firewalls. For more information, refer to Licensing Support. More than one application that uses the FLEXnet (previously known as FLEXlm) License Tools is running on the network. If this is the case, review the FLEXnet Licensing End User’s Guide, which has a section entitled “Managing Licenses from Multiple Vendors”. Note that for most setups, only one version of lmgrd.exe should be run on any network, and that version must be the latest one installed. See also the FAQ entitled “How do I use FLEXnet Licensing with more than one product?”. Problem: The serial number already exists. Solution: The VisualDSP++ License Manager has detected that the serial number you are trying to install already exists in your license.dat file. Problem: The serial number entered is not a server serial number. Please enter a serial number that was created for the server. Solution: The VisualDSP++ License Manager has detected that the serial number you are trying to install is a node-locked license serial number. The Floating License Server is not required for use with this type of license. Install your node-locked license through the VisualDSP++ IDDE. Refer to Installing a Node-Locked License for further details.
VisualDSP++ 5 Licensing Guide 6-25 Troubleshooting Problem: The serial number you entered is invalid. Please re-enter the number, ensuring that you type the number EXACTLY as shown on the registration card. Solution: Ensure that you have typed in the correct serial number, exactly as given. If you continue to have problems, contact Support, sending your serial number and \System\license.dat file, if available. For more information, see Licensing Support. Problem: The serial number you have entered is no longer valid. Please contact Support ([email protected] or 1-800-analogd) to update your serial number. Solution: The VisualDSP++ License Manager has detected that the serial number you are trying to install is no longer valid. Certain serial numbers have been made obsolete over the years. Contact Support with your cur- rent serial number, and you will be issued with a replacement. For more information, see Licensing Support. Problem: The validation code that you entered is invalid. Please re-enter the code, ensuring that you type the code EXACTLY as you received it. It might be helpful to copy-and-paste your validation code rather than typing it manually. Solution: The VisualDSP++ License Manager has detected that you entered an invalid validation code. Enter your validation code exactly as given. Validation codes are valid for a particular serial number and host ID combination. If you are trying to install your serial number on a different machine than the one you initially registered, you will require a new validation code. Refer to Registering and Vali- dating Your License for further details.
Error Messages 6-26 VisualDSP++ 5 Licensing GuideFrom VisualDSP++ 5 onwards, license strings (and therefore validation codes), have changed in format. Consequently, when registering your serial number and host ID, two validation codes will be e-mailed to you. One is valid for VisualDSP++ 4.5 and earlier versions; the other is valid for VisualDSP++ 5 and later versions. Ensure that you install the appro- priate validation code for the version of VisualDSP++ you are using. If you continue to have problems, e-mail processor.tools.registra- [email protected] , identifying your serial number, validation code, and host ID. Problem: Invalid license file. The license file may either be damaged or miss- ing. Please confirm that the following file exists: C:\Program Files\Analog Devices\VisualDSP\LMSERVER\license.dat Solution: The VisualDSP++ License Manager had a problem accessing the license.dat file located in the \LMSERVER folder. This can be caused by the LMSERVER folder or the license.dat file itself having “read only” permission, by the file currently being opened by another application, or by another disk/file access problem. Verify that the file and disk drive have the proper settings to enable copying files and try again. This can also be caused by the license.dat file including invalid information. If the problem persists, contact Support for further assistance. For more information, see Licensing Support. Problem: Failed to copy the license file to license.bak Solution: The VisualDSP++ License Manager was not able to create the backup license file \LMSERVER\license.bak. This can be the result of a read/write permission issue on the LMSERVER folder in the VisualDSP++ install directory, a lack of disk space, the file attributes on